Local media: Korea's Fair Trade Commission raided Apple's Seoul offices over allegations it is charging App Store IAP fees of 33%, rather than the stated 30% — Officials from Korea's Fair Trade Commission conducted a dawn raid on Apple's offices in Gangnam-gu, Seoul, over allegations …
